Location Magic

Here’s what actually matters about staying in Navona — you’re literally in the beating heart of Rome. When I say heart, I don’t mean some marketing nonsense; I mean you step outside and the Pantheon is a three-minute walk away. The Piazza Navona (with those incredible Bernini fountains) is right there, and you know what? You’ll find yourself wandering back to it every evening because it’s just that beautiful. The narrow cobblestone streets around here are lined with family-run trattorias that locals actually eat at, not just the tourist spots with English menus plastered outside.

  • Tech from Norway (9/10)

    Breakfast was two croissants each morning for each of the three "luxury" rooms we stayed at one of, put out early each morning on the table, with a sign for your room's name (we stayed in "Bellini").

    There is a small minibar fridge in your room that fits a minimum of spread/meat for bread, yogurt and some milk, beer and soda (but beware of limited space).

    Important: There is a wine bottle opener in your room! Haha, this is obviously critical. 😉 Two wine glasses in our room.

    There's a water kettle in the room which was very useful.

    The bathroom is nice and was very clean, but you cannot be very obese if you want to squeeze into the narrow opening for the shower (I had to scrape through). Very clean and nice, though. Shampoo there.

    Alina, the host, was very helpful with tips for supermarket, restaurants, etc. and speaks English well, unlike many Italians.

    There's a small grocery store just 50 meters from the door to the apartment building. Tons of restaurants nearby.

    The room is up some very steep, at times narrow, stairs, so you need to be somewhat fit to manage!

    The kitchen and chairs/table is in a shared area between the three rooms. There's a Nespresso maker for coffee in the shared area – I recommend bringing some instant coffee for use in the privacy of your room with water from the kettle. The kitchen is limited and not very well equipped, but there are plates, a few knives, forks, spoons, cups and stuff you need.

    It's a quite small room with no furniture except for the bed. There are two chairs and a table on the terrace which was a must for getting my required nicotine dose!

    It was overall a very nice experience and a good place to stay. The location is extremely good, so close to many restaurants and sights, just a few minutes walk away.

    Thanks for welcoming me (a man) and my wife (a female) warmly and helping us manage our early arrival on the first day.
